Ingredients of taisen's almost greek salad

  1. You need 1 of lettuce and or romaine lettuce.
  2. Prepare 1 small of to medium red onion.
  3. You need 1 can of of pitted black olives or you can use greek pitted olives.
  4. Prepare 1 of sunflower seeds.
  5. You need 1 of feta cheese crumbled.
  6. Prepare 1 of tomato if you desire. I didn't have any so I skipped that.
  7. You need 1 of anything else you wish to add in.
  8. It's 1 of any brand of greek dressing.

taisen's almost greek salad instructions

  1. rinse lettuce and or romaine.
  2. chop lettuce and romaine up into bite size or larger if you like.
  3. add them to a big salad bowl.
  4. peel , rinse and chop onion however you like. add into the bowl.
  5. open the olives. drain juice. you can either leave them whole or slice in half. add into the bowl.
  6. take sunflower seeds and sprinkle how much you want into the bowl.
  7. put the crumbled feta cheese in the bowl..
  8. you can add anything else you like to the bowl.
  9. mix if you like or leave as is. you can also cover this and put in the fridge for later or serve now..
  10. serve this in separate bowls and pour some dressing in. mux and eat. enjoy with any meal.
